London banks go Middle East

London’s big investment banks are dramatically stepping up their presence in the Middle East in an effort to seek new clients.

While the choices are rarely as stark as “move to Dubai or be fired”, big bank employees, from managing directors down to young analysts, are being encouraged to consider a stint in the Gulf or nearby countries.

Many are jumping at the chance. Some are simply excited about getting into an area where business is hot. Others are capitalising on family connections to the area, or language skills that give them an edge.

Although the numbers do not compare with the tens of thousands of people losing their jobs in London and New York, virtually all banks are beefing up their Middle Eastern presence.
